The integrated turbulence forecasting algorithm (ITFA), which produces timely clear-air turbulence (CAT) forecasts for the contiguous United States, is described. In support of the ITFA development, an event-driven meteorological evaluation of the ITFA was performed from 1 January to 30 April 2000. The evaluation focused on correlating ITFA predictions to reports of moderate or greater CAT, the meteorological conditions that produced the turbulence, and assessing the operational impact of the ITFA predictions.
